The K-3 in live view does not stop the lens down to the set aperture in any mode. Screen brightness, OTOH, follows the apparent exposure (dimmer when underexposed, brighter when overexposed) by adjusting the screen brightness.
Yes...With live view on the K-3, you must use the DOF prevew to view DOF with the lens stopped down.
According to Adam, the K-1 behaves differently than the K-3.

Is this with the K-1? The behavior with my K-3 (firmware v. 1.11) is somewhat different. In all modes, M included, the lens may stop down in live view in response to the amount of light in the frame. The DOF preview button is required to stop the lens down to the set value. Aperture is wide open during AF and with magnification. Real time exposure preview is handled by adjusting screen brightness.
